Well a 42T rear sprocket will give you alot more bottom end..I am sure you will have to remove the rear skid plate to add it, but I dont see what the problem would be..you wouldnt have much for top end, but if you were into climbing go for it..I mean, at least try and and see how you like it..If you dont like it take it off..since you already have it experiment with it..
